885
小米6
如何連接阿裏雲數據庫
前言
阿裏雲數據庫是阿裏巴巴集團旗下的雲數據庫服務,提供了豐富的數據庫類型和靈活的管理功能。本文將詳細介紹如何連接阿裏雲數據庫,幫助您快速建立連接並開始使用數據庫。
準備工作
在連接阿裏雲數據庫之前,您需要準備好以下信息:
- 數據庫類型和版本
- 數據庫實例地址
- 數據庫端口號
- 數據庫用戶名
- 數據庫密碼
以上信息可以在阿裏雲數據庫控製台中獲取。登錄控製台,選擇您的數據庫實例,即可在概覽頁麵查看這些信息。
連接步驟
以下是連接阿裏雲數據庫的具體步驟: ### 1. 安裝數據庫客戶端根據您使用的數據庫類型,安裝對應的數據庫客戶端。例如,對於 MySQL 數據庫,您需要安裝 MySQL 客戶端;對於 PostgreSQL 數據庫,您需要安裝 PostgreSQL 客戶端。
### 2. 確定連接參數使用準備好的數據庫信息,確定連接參數:
- 主機:數據庫實例地址
- 端口:數據庫端口號
- 用戶名:數據庫用戶名
- 密碼:數據庫密碼
使用您的數據庫客戶端建立連接,語法如下:
``` mysql -h [主機地址] -P [端口號] -u [用戶名] -p[密碼] ```例如,連接到 MySQL 數據庫:
``` mysql -h 127.0.0.1 -P 3306 -u root -ppassword ```使用 JDBC 連接
您還可以使用 JDBC(Java 數據庫連接)建立連接,語法如下:
```java import .*; public class DbConnect { // 數據庫連接信息 private static final String HOST = "127.0.0.1"; private static final int PORT = 3306; private static final String USERNAME = "root"; private static final String PASSWORD = "password"; private static final String DATABASE = "my_db"; public static void main(String[] args) { try { // 加載驅動 (""); // 建立連接 Connection conn = ( "jdbc:mysql://" + HOST + ":" + PORT + "/" + DATABASE, USERNAME, PASSWORD ); // 執行 SQL 語句 Statement stmt = (); ResultSet rs = ("SELECT * FROM users"); // 處理結果 while (()) { (("username")); } // 關閉連接 (); (); (); } catch (Exception e) { (); } } } ```使用 Python 連接
您還可以使用 Python 連接阿裏雲數據庫,語法如下:
```python import # 數據庫連接信息 HOST = '127.0.0.1' PORT = 3306 USERNAME = 'root' PASSWORD = 'password' DATABASE = 'my_db' # 建立連接 connection = ( host=HOST, port=PORT, user=USERNAME, password=PASSWORD, database=DATABASE ) # 創建遊標 cursor = () # 執行 SQL 語句 ("SELECT * FROM users") # 處理結果 for (name, age) in (): print(name, age) # 關閉連接 () () ``` ### 4. 測試連接建立連接後,您可以執行一些簡單的 SQL 語句來測試連接是否成功,例如:
```sql SELECT 1; ```如果語句執行成功,則表明連接成功。
常見問題
### 連接失敗怎麼辦?連接失敗可能是由於以下原因:
- 數據庫實例未啟動或不可用
- 連接參數不正確
- 安全組規則限製了訪問
- 網絡問題
您可以通過阿裏雲數據庫控製台或命令行工具修改數據庫密碼。
### 如何連接到遠程數據庫?如果您需要連接到位於其他網絡或地域的數據庫,您需要設置白名單規則或配置 VPN。
通過遵循本文中的步驟,您應該能夠成功連接到阿裏雲數據庫。如果您遇到任何問題,可以參考阿裏雲文檔或聯係阿裏雲客服尋求支持。
最後更新:2024-12-17 13:37:27
上一篇:
阿裏雲數據庫使用入門
下一篇:
雅虎郵箱安全綁定阿裏雲服務器
使用Dashboard__快速入門_雲監控-阿裏雲
阿裏雲使用什麼係統好?全方位解析阿裏雲係統選擇指南
RAM子帳號訪問控製台__常見問題_日誌服務-阿裏雲
創建應用分組__應用分組_用戶指南_雲監控-阿裏雲
接入協議__設備基於MQTT接入_設備端接入手冊_阿裏雲物聯網套件-阿裏雲
ApiTrafficControlItem__數據類型_API_API 網關-阿裏雲
WAF源站負載均衡__常見接入問題_Web 應用防火牆-阿裏雲
對象存儲OSS控製台—總體概覽頁__視頻專區_對象存儲 OSS-阿裏雲
專屬賬號申請流程?__充值介紹_賬戶資產_財務-阿裏雲
效果報表__用戶指南_推薦引擎-阿裏雲
相關內容
常見錯誤說明__附錄_大數據計算服務-阿裏雲
發送短信接口__API使用手冊_短信服務-阿裏雲
接口文檔__Android_安全組件教程_移動安全-阿裏雲
運營商錯誤碼(聯通)__常見問題_短信服務-阿裏雲
設置短信模板__使用手冊_短信服務-阿裏雲
OSS 權限問題及排查__常見錯誤及排除_最佳實踐_對象存儲 OSS-阿裏雲
消息通知__操作指南_批量計算-阿裏雲
設備端快速接入(MQTT)__快速開始_阿裏雲物聯網套件-阿裏雲
查詢API調用流量數據__API管理相關接口_API_API 網關-阿裏雲
使用STS訪問__JavaScript-SDK_SDK 參考_對象存儲 OSS-阿裏雲